Take a guided tour of the historic churches and museums
Tiradentes is home to a number of beautiful churches and museums that offer insight into the town's rich history and culture. In December, you can take guided tours of these historic landmarks, learning about their architecture, artwork, and significance. Many of the churches host special Christmas services and events, and the museums often feature holiday-themed exhibits and activities. It's a fascinating way to delve into the heritage of Tiradentes and gain a deeper appreciation for the town's traditions.
Sample the local Christmas treats at the markets and bakeries
December is a time for indulging in delicious holiday treats, and Tiradentes is no exception. The town's markets and bakeries are filled with traditional Christmas sweets and snacks, such as pão de queijo (cheese bread), biscoitos de polvilho (cassava flour cookies), and various types of homemade chocolates and candies. You can also try special holiday drinks like quentão, a warm mulled wine spiked with spices. It's a festive way to satisfy your sweet tooth and experience the flavors of the season.

Take a scenic train ride on the Maria Fumaça
The Maria Fumaça is a historic steam train that runs between Tiradentes and São João del Rei, offering a scenic journey through the countryside. In December, the train is decked out in holiday decorations, and there are special Christmas-themed rides with live music, entertainment, and even visits from Santa Claus. The festive atmosphere and stunning views make it a memorable way to experience the beauty of the region during the holiday season.

Weather in Tiradentes in December

Temperatures on an average day in Tiradentes in December

The average temperature in Tiradentes in December for a typical day ranges from a high of 80°F (26°C) to a low of 64°F (18°C). Some would describe it as pleasantly warm with a gentle breeze.

For comparison, the hottest month in Tiradentes, September, has days with highs of 86°F (30°C) and lows of 57°F (14°C). The coldest month, July has days with highs of 78°F (26°C) and lows of 52°F (11°C). This graph shows how an average day looks like in Tiradentes in December based on historical data.
